And the cake? Of course I was in charge of it!
I made a tres leches cake: two layers of sponge cake (which turned out divine), soaked in tres leches mix, filled with chocolate fudge, and covered with Masscream. The finishing touch? Cherries on top with their stems still attached—I’d bought them some days ago, and they made the cake look so elegant.
